Lagos School Denies Expelling Students Over Complaints About Poor Curriculum

by Royal Ibeh
2 years ago
in News
Share on WhatsAppShare on FacebookShare on XTelegram

 

Advertisement

GMYT Fashion Academy, Lagos, has debunked reports that it expelled students for complaining about poor curriculum after paying N645,000 training fee.

The rebuttal followed a report by an online news platform, titled “Lagos Fashion School, GMYT, Reportedly Expels Students for Complaining About Poor Curriculum After Paying N645,000 Training Fee.”

In a statement, the management of the Academy expressed disappointment in what they perceived as a lack of depth in investigative journalism.

They claimed that the platform had a prepared story before reaching out to GMYT’s GMD, Princess Kelechi Oghene, and deliberately edited her response to fit their own narrative.

The management said: “Let us begin by acknowledging the concerns raised by some of our students regarding their experiences at GMYT Fashion Academy. We take these concerns seriously and are committed to addressing them in a fair and constructive manner.

“At GMYT Fashion Academy, we have a rich history in the fashion industry, spanning over 18 years. In that time, we have trained thousands of students, including those who benefited from our foundation programs, entirely free of charge. Our dedication to fashion education is unwavering, and this commitment is reflected in our comprehensive curriculum and state-of-the-art facilities.

“The MD/CEO of GMYT Fashion Academy, Princess Kelechi Oghene has personally dedicated her life to the fashion industry, enriching her expertise through formal education at esteemed institutions like the Lagos Business School, Harvard Business School, and the London College of Fashion. Currently, she’s furthering her knowledge at the Business School Netherlands. GMYT Fashion Academy reflects this dedication, aiming to provide the best education and environment for our students.

“Regarding the concerns raised by our students, it’s crucial to emphasize that we continuously strive for improvement. We will certainly look into any grievances and feedback provided by students. Dismissing students is not a decision we take lightly, and it involves a thorough evaluation process.

“The management also extend an invitation to any investigator for a more in-depth discussion or interview on this matter. Additionally, the media is free to interact with our diverse alumni base, who can attest to the impact of GMYT Fashion Academy on their careers.

“We look forward to ensuring that the narrative surrounding GMYT Fashion Academy is accurate, fair, and reflective of our institution’s integrity.”
